Image
By mk Founder on Tag: Kubernetes, Cloud Computing, Open Source, CNCF
Kubernetes

Kubernetes ออกเวอร์ชัน 1.10 ซึ่งถือเป็นการออกรุ่นใหม่ครั้งแรกของปี 2018 ฟีเจอร์ใหม่ที่สำคัญแยกออกเป็น 3 ด้าน

By mk Founder on Tag: WSL, Linux, Windows 10, Microsoft, Open Source
WSL

เราเห็นดิสโทรลินุกซ์ดังๆ อย่าง Ubuntu, Debian, Kali, SUSE ทยอยกันมาลง Microsoft Store ให้ใช้งานได้บน Windows 10 ผ่าน WSL (Windows Subsystem for Linux) ของไมโครซอฟท์

แต่ไมโครซอฟท์ยังไม่หยุดแค่นั้น เพราะล่าสุดประกาศโอเพนซอร์สตัวอย่างโค้ดของลินุกซ์ที่รันบน WSL เพื่อให้ดิสโทรลินุกซ์ใดๆ ก็ได้สามารถรันบน WSL ได้เช่นกัน

By mk Founder on Tag: webOS, LG, Open Source, Operating System
webOS

เราได้ยินชื่อ webOS กันครั้งสุดท้ายหลัง LG ซื้อต่อจาก HP ในปี 2013 แล้วนำไปใช้ในผลิตภัณฑ์สมาร์ททีวีของตัวเอง ซึ่งก็ยังวางขายมาเรื่อยๆ อย่างต่อเนื่องจนถึงทุกวันนี้

เมื่อสัปดาห์ที่แล้ว LG ประกาศโอเพนซอร์ส webOS เวอร์ชันของตัวเอง (ก่อนหน้านี้ webOS เคยโอเพนซอร์สมาแล้วในยุค HP) โดยใช้ชื่อว่า webOS Open Source Edition (OSE) และเริ่มนับเลขเวอร์ชันใหม่เป็น 1.0

By mk Founder on Tag: Java, Oracle, Programming, Open Source
Java

รวดเร็วปานจรวด เพียง 6 เดือนหลังจาก Java SE 9 ในเดือนกันยายนปีที่แล้ว ก็ได้เวลาของ Java SE 10 ครับ

การออก Java 10 อยู่ภายใต้นโยบายใหม่ของ Oracle ที่จะออก Java รุ่นใหม่ทุก 6 เดือน ลักษณะเดียวกับที่เราเห็นในซอฟต์แวร์โอเพนซอร์สหลายโครงการ โดย Java 10 ถือเป็นรุ่นแรกที่ใช้ระบบออกรุ่นแบบใหม่นี้ และมีเลขเวอร์ชันอีกแบบคือ 18.3 (ปี.เดือน)

By mk Founder on Tag: Kubernetes, Google, Ubisoft, Games, Server, Open Source
Kubernetes

กูเกิลเปิดตัวโครงการ Agones ไลบรารีสำหรับรันเซิร์เวอร์เกมบนเทคโนโลยีจัดการเซิร์ฟเวอร์สมัยใหม่ Kubernetes

การรันเซิร์ฟเวอร์เกมในปัจจุบันมีความท้าทายในการรองรับผู้เล่นจำนวนมากๆ ที่เข้ามาเล่นเกมพร้อมกัน ในขณะที่ Kubernetes กลายเป็นโซลูชันมาตรฐานของการประมวลผลแบบกระจายในยุคคลาวด์ กูเกิลจึงจับมือกับ Ubisoft พัฒนา Agones เพื่อให้ใช้ Kubernetes รันเซิร์ฟเวอร์เกมได้สะดวกขึ้น

By nutmos Writer on Tag: GNOME, Open Source
GNOME

GNOME ออกเวอร์ชันใหม่ตามรอบ 6 เดือน รอบนี้ใช้เลขเวอร์ชัน 3.28 โค้ดเนมว่า Chongqing ตามสถานที่ประชุมของนักพัฒนาประจำเวอร์ชัน (ปีนี้จัดที่ Chongqing ประเทศจีน) โดยมีฟีเจอร์ใหม่และการปรับปรุงหลายอย่าง เช่น

By mk Founder on Tag: Google, Open Source, Audio, Augmented Reality, Virtual Reality
Google

เมื่อปลายปีที่แล้ว กูเกิลออก Resonance Audio ซอฟต์แวร์ช่วยจัดการเสียง 360 องศาสำหรับโลก AR/VR เพื่ออำนวยความสะดวกให้การสร้างประสบการณ์ AR/VR สมจริงยิ่งขึ้น

ตัวอย่างแอพที่นำ Resonance Audio ไปใช้งานคือ Coco VR ของบริษัท Pixar ที่ใช้บน Oculus และ Gear VR

By lew Founder on Tag: LLVM, Open Source, Programming
LLVM

LLVM โครงการเฟรมเวิร์คสำหรับการสร้างคอมไพล์เลอร์ ออกเวอร์ชั่น 6.0 โดยฟีเจอร์สำคัญที่สุดคงเป็นการอิมพลีเมนต์ Retpoline ป้องกันการโจมตี Spectre

ฟีเจอร์สำหรับ x86 ที่เพิ่มมาคือการรองรับคำสั่งและซีพียูใหม่ๆ ดีขึ้นมาก เช่น สามารถใช้ชุดคำสั่ง AVX512 ในซีพียูอินเทลได้ดีขึ้น รองรับการคอมไพล์โค้ดให้ตรงกับซีพียูรุ่นใหม่ๆ ของทั้งอินเทลและเอเอ็มดี ในแง่ของระบบปฎิบัติการก็รองรับการออกข้อมูลดีบัก CodeView ได้สมบูรณ์กว่าเดิม

By lew Founder on Tag: Electronics, UPS, Open Source
Electronics

Eric S. Raymond (ESR) หนึ่งในผู้บุกเบิกวงการโอเพนซอร์ส เปิดตัวโครงการออกแบบ UPSide ออกแบบ UPS โอเพนซอร์สทั้งฮาร์ดแวร์และซอฟต์แวร์ เพื่อให้สามารถผลิตได้ง่าย, ตรวจสอบการทำงานได้

สเปคของ UPSide ระบุถึงปัญหาของ UPS ทุกวันนี้ว่ามีปัญหาหลายอย่าง เช่น การชาร์จที่ทำให้อายุแบตเตอรี่ลดลง, การรายงานค่าต่างๆ ไม่เป็นมาตรฐาน

โครงการ UPSide ตั้งเป้าจะออกแบบ UPS ที่ผลิตได้ในราคาไม่แพงนักด้วยปริมาณที่ไม่มากเกินไป ทำให้ต้องออกแบบวงจรที่ไม่ซับซ้อน ไม่มีชิปแบบ BGA, หากเป็นแบบ SMT ก็ต้องขนาดไม่เล็กเกินไป, และใช้จำนวนชั้นของ PCB ให้น้อยที่สุดแม้บอร์ดจะใหญ่ขึ้น

By tanersirakorn Contributor on Tag: Google, Font, Open Source
Google

โครงการ Noto ซึ่งเป็นโครงการฟอนต์โอเพ่นซอร์สของกูเกิล ดำเนินงานมาเป็นระยะเวลานานแล้ว หนึ่งในภาษาที่รองรับมาตั้งแต่ต้นคือภาษาไทย โดยใช้ตัวแบบอักษรเดียวกับฟอนต์ Droid Sans ในโทรศัพท์แอนดรอยด์

ไม่นานมานี้ ชุดตัวอักษรภาษาไทยในโครงการถูกปรับเปลี่ยนให้เป็นแบบอักษรชุดใหม่ที่ออกแบบโดยคัดสรร ดีมาก ซึ่งเป็นเจ้าของผลงานฟอนต์สุขุมวิท และฟอนต์ภาษาไทยบน Google Fonts

By lew Founder on Tag: Security Patch, Security, Open Source
Security Patch

Meh Chang นักวิจัยจากบริษัท DEVCORE ในไต้หวันรายงานช่องโหว่ใน mail transfer agent (MTA) ที่ชื่อว่า Exim ที่ได้รับความนิยมเป็นอย่างสูงในลินุกซ์ สามารถควบคุมหน่วยความจำบางส่วนของ Exim และอาจเปิดทางให้แฮกเกอร์รันโค้ดบนเซิร์ฟเวอร์ได้

การโจมตีอาศัยช่องโหว่ buffer overflow ในฟังก์ชั่น base64d โดยอาศัยการส่งคำสั่ง ELHO และ AUTH พร้อมกับข้อมูลที่ออกแบบมาเฉพาะ อย่างไรก็ดีทีมงานพัฒนาระบุว่าการโจมตีจริงน่าจะทำได้ยาก

By mk Founder on Tag: Jakarta EE, Java, Eclipse, Open Source, Trademark
Jakarta EE

หลังจาก Java EE กลายเป็นโครงการในสังกัดของ Eclipse Foundation และใช้ชื่อโครงการว่า EE4J เพื่อเลี่ยงการใช้เครื่องหมายการค้า Java ที่ยังเป็นของ Oracle

ล่าสุดโครงการ EE4J ประกาศชื่อแบรนด์ใหม่ของ Java EE ว่าเป็น Jakarta EE

By lew Founder on Tag: Xen, Open Source, Kickstarter
Xen

XenServer เวอร์ชั่น 7.3 รุ่นโอเพนซอร์สเริ่มปล่อยตัวจริงเมื่อปลายปีที่แล้ว แต่ปรากฎว่ามีการตัดฟีเจอร์สำคัญไปจำนวนมาก เช่น Xen storage motion, จำกัดขนาด pool ที่ 3 เครื่อง, dynamic memory control ทำให้ Xen Orchrestra บริษัทผู้ผลิตซอฟต์แวร์ควบคุม Xen Server ออกมาประกาศโครงการ XCP-ng สร้างเซิร์ฟเวอร์ที่ไม่ตัดฟีเจอร์อีก

XCP-ng นำโค้ดมาจาก XenServer และคอมไพล์ใหม่เพื่อนำฟีเจอร์ที่ถูกตัดออกไปกลับเข้ามา และดูแลกันต่อในรูปแบบโครงการของชุมชนเต็มร้อย จากเดิมที่ XenServer เป็นโครงการโอเพนซอร์สที่ดูแลโดยทีมงานของ Citrix เป็นหลัก

By mk Founder on Tag: LibreOffice, Open Source
LibreOffice

มูลนิธิ The Document Foundation ออกซอฟต์แวร์ LibreOffice 6.0 ถือเป็นการออกเวอร์ชันใหญ่ครั้งแรกในรอบ 2 ปีครึ่ง (เวอร์ชัน 5.0 ออกสิงหาคม 2015) ของใหม่ที่สำคัญมีดังนี้

By mk Founder on Tag: CoreOS, Red Hat, Open Source, Acquisition, Container, Kubernetes, Enterprise
CoreOS

Red Hat ประกาศซื้อบริษัท CoreOS หนึ่งในผู้บุกเบิกวงการ container ในราคา 250 ล้านดอลลาร์

CoreOS เป็นสตาร์ตอัพที่ก่อตั้งในปี 2013 โดยพัฒนาระบบปฏิบัติการลินุกซ์ขนาดเล็กชื่อ Container Linux เหมาะสำหรับ container และได้รับความนิยมอย่างมากในตลาดคลาวด์ โดยมีทั้ง Google Cloud, DigitalOcean, Azure ให้การสนับสนุน

By mk Founder on Tag: Linux, Open Source, Linux Foundation, Server
Linux

ปกติแล้วเรามักคุ้นเคยกับลินุกซ์ในฐานะของ "ระบบปฏิบัติการ" แต่ล่าสุด ลินุกซ์กำลังจะก้าวข้ามพรมแดนไปอยู่ในเฟิร์มแวร์ตอนบูตเครื่องก่อนเข้าสู่ระบบปฏิบัติการด้วย

มูลนิธิ Linux Foundation เพิ่งเปิดตัวโครงการ LinuxBoot เพื่อนำโค้ดของลินุกซ์ไปใช้ในเฟิร์มแวร์ของเซิร์ฟเวอร์ ปกติแล้ว เฟิร์มแวร์ของคอมพิวเตอร์ประกอบด้วยโค้ดหลายส่วน เช่น ส่วนที่บูตฮาร์ดแวร์ในช่วงแรก (hardware init - UEFI PEI) และส่วนที่เริ่มการทำงานของหน่วยความจำ (memory initialized) ซึ่ง LinuxBoot จะเข้ามาทำหน้าที่แทนโค้ดส่วนหลัง (UEFI DXE)

By mk Founder on Tag: Wine, Emulator, Open Source
Wine

Wine ซอฟต์แวร์อีมูเลเตอร์โอเพนซอร์สชื่อดัง ออกเวอร์ชัน 3.0 ตามรอบการออกรุ่นแบบใหม่ที่ออกรุ่นใหญ่ปีละครั้ง (ข่าวรุ่น 2.0 ตอนต้นปี 2017) ของใหม่ที่สำคัญได้แก่

  • รองรับ Direct3D 10 และ 11
  • รองรับ Direct3D command stream
  • รองรับไดรเวอร์กราฟิกของ Android
  • ปรับปรุง DirectWrite และ Direct2D
  • ปรับปรุง UI ใหม่หลายจุด ให้รองรับจอความละเอียดสูง HiDPI ได้ีขึ้น

Wine ประกาศว่าในเวอร์ชันหน้าจะรองรับฟีเจอร์ใหญ่ๆ อย่าง Direct3D 12, Vulkan และการรองรับ OpenGL ES เพื่อเรียกใช้ Direct3D บน Android

By lew Founder on Tag: OpenWRT, Open Source
OpenWRT

โครงการ LEDE แยกตัวออกจาก OpenWRT ตั้งแต่ปี 2016 จากความไม่พอใจที่นักพัฒนารับโค้ดช้า แต่เพียงปีเดียวก็มีการพูดคุยว่าจะกลับมารวมโครงการกัน ตอนนี้กระบวนการรวมโครงการก็เรียบร้อยแล้ว

แม้จะบอกว่าเป็นการรวมโครงการกัน แต่ในทางปฎิบัติแล้วเหมือนว่า LEDE จะเป็นผู้ชนะ โดยโค้ดหลักจะมาจาก LEDE รวมถึงกติกาชุมชน แต่ในแง่ขององค์กร OpenWRT เป็นโครงการภายใต้ Software in the Public Interest (SPI) องค์กรไม่แสวงหากำไรที่มีสิทธิรับบริจาคเพื่อลดภาษีอยู่

By mk Founder on Tag: PowerShell, Microsoft, Open Source
PowerShell

เมื่อปี 2016 ไมโครซอฟท์ประกาศโอเพนซอร์ส PowerShell ตามหลังการโอเพนซอร์ส .NET และเปิดให้ใช้งาน PowerShell ข้ามแพลตฟอร์ม ใช้บนลินุกซ์และแมคได้ด้วย แต่ช่วงแรกยังมีสถานะเป็นรุ่น Alpha เท่านั้น

เวลาผ่านมาเกือบสองปี ในที่สุดไมโครซอฟท์ก็ออกซอพต์แวร์รุ่นจริง โดยใช้ชื่อเรียกว่า PowerShell Core (เหมือน .NET Core) นับเลขเวอร์ชันเป็น 6.0 ต่อจาก Windows PowerShell รุ่นปัจจุบัน (5.1)

การแยกรุ่น PowerShell ทำให้ตอนนี้ซอฟต์แวร์ถูกแยกออกเป็น 2 สาย (เหมือน .NET) คือ

By mk Founder on Tag: Lineage OS, Android, Open Source
Lineage OS

LineageOS โครงการผู้สืบทอดจิตวิญญาณจาก CyanogenMod มีอายุครบ 1 ปีแล้ว

ทางโครงการสรุปสถิติในหนึ่งปีแรก มีอุปกรณ์ที่รองรับ 180 รุ่นจาก 23 ยี่ห้อ, มีอุปกรณ์ใช้งาน 1.7 ล้านเครื่องในรอบ 90 วันล่าสุด, มีผู้ร่วมพัฒนามากกว่า 700 คน โดย 65% ทำงานด้านแปลภาษา

5 อันดับแรกของอุปกรณ์ยอดนิยมในโลกของ LineageOS ได้แก่ OnePlus One, Galaxy S3, Redmi Note 4, Moto G 2015, Galaxy S5 และประเทศที่มีผู้ใช้งานเยอะที่สุดคือ อินเดีย จีน บราซิล รัสเซีย เยอรมนี

Subscribe to Open Source